Environment, climate unlikely to tip scales on Election Day

2014-10-25 16:00:00| Climate Ark Climate Change & Global Warming Newsfeed

Greenwire: Climate change and the environment aren't likely to be the dominant factors swaying midterm races across the country next month. That's according to recent polls gauging voters' priorities when they head to the polls on Election Day.
